28 #include <sys/cdefs.h>
29 #include <sys/param.h>
30 #include <sys/kernel.h>
31 #include <sys/lock.h>
32 #include <sys/mutex.h>
33 #include <sys/smp.h>
34 #include <sys/systm.h>
35
36 #include <machine/atomic.h>
37 #include <machine/param.h>
38
39 #include <vm/vm.h>
40 #include <vm/pmap.h>
41
42 enum {
43     ATOMIC64_ADD,
44     ATOMIC64_CLEAR,
45     ATOMIC64_CMPSET,
46     ATOMIC64_FCMPSET,
47     ATOMIC64_FETCHADD,
48     ATOMIC64_LOAD,
49     ATOMIC64_SET,
50     ATOMIC64_SUBTRACT,
51     ATOMIC64_STORE,
52     ATOMIC64_SWAP
53 };
54
55 #ifdef _KERNEL
56 #ifdef SMP
57
58 #define A64_POOL_SIZE   MAXCPU
59 /* Estimated size of a cacheline */
60 #define CACHE_ALIGN     CACHE_LINE_SIZE
61 static struct mtx a64_mtx_pool[A64_POOL_SIZE];
62
63 #define GET_MUTEX(p) \
64     (&a64_mtx_pool[(pmap_kextract((vm_offset_t)p) / CACHE_ALIGN) % (A64_POOL_SIZE)])
65
66 #define LOCK_A64()                      \
67     struct mtx *_amtx = GET_MUTEX(p);   \
68     if (smp_started) mtx_lock(_amtx)
69
70 #define UNLOCK_A64()    if (smp_started) mtx_unlock(_amtx)
71
72 #else   /* !SMP */
73
74 #define LOCK_A64()      { register_t s = intr_disable()
75 #define UNLOCK_A64()    intr_restore(s); }
76
77 #endif  /* SMP */
78
79 #define ATOMIC64_EMU_UN(op, rt, block, ret) \
80     rt \
81     atomic_##op##_64(volatile u_int64_t *p) {                   \
82         u_int64_t tmp __unused;                                 \
83         LOCK_A64();                                             \
84         block;                                                  \
85         UNLOCK_A64();                                           \
86         ret; } struct hack
87
88 #define ATOMIC64_EMU_BIN(op, rt, block, ret) \
89     rt \
90     atomic_##op##_64(volatile u_int64_t *p, u_int64_t v) {      \
91         u_int64_t tmp __unused;                                 \
92         LOCK_A64();                                             \
93         block;                                                  \
94         UNLOCK_A64();                                           \
95         ret; } struct hack
96
97 ATOMIC64_EMU_BIN(add, void, (*p = *p + v), return);
98 ATOMIC64_EMU_BIN(clear, void, *p &= ~v, return);
99 ATOMIC64_EMU_BIN(fetchadd, u_int64_t, (*p = *p + v, v = *p - v), return (v));
100 ATOMIC64_EMU_UN(load, u_int64_t, (tmp = *p), return (tmp));
101 ATOMIC64_EMU_BIN(set, void, *p |= v, return);
102 ATOMIC64_EMU_BIN(subtract, void, (*p = *p - v), return);
103 ATOMIC64_EMU_BIN(store, void, *p = v, return);
104 ATOMIC64_EMU_BIN(swap, u_int64_t, tmp = *p; *p = v; v = tmp, return(v));
105
106 int atomic_cmpset_64(volatile u_int64_t *p, u_int64_t old, u_int64_t new)
107 {
108         u_int64_t tmp;
109
110         LOCK_A64();
111         tmp = *p;
112         if (tmp == old)
113                 *p = new;
114         UNLOCK_A64();
115
116         return (tmp == old);
117 }
118
119 int atomic_fcmpset_64(volatile u_int64_t *p, u_int64_t *old, u_int64_t new)
120 {
121         u_int64_t tmp, tmp_old;
122
123         LOCK_A64();
124         tmp = *p;
125         tmp_old = *old;
126         if (tmp == tmp_old)
127                 *p = new;
128         else
129                 *old = tmp;
130         UNLOCK_A64();
131
132         return (tmp == tmp_old);
133 }
134
135 #ifdef SMP
136 static void
137 atomic64_mtxinit(void *x __unused)
138 {
139         int i;
140
141         for (i = 0; i < A64_POOL_SIZE; i++)
142                 mtx_init(&a64_mtx_pool[i], "atomic64 mutex", NULL, MTX_DEF);
143 }
144
145 SYSINIT(atomic64_mtxinit, SI_SUB_LOCK, SI_ORDER_MIDDLE, atomic64_mtxinit, NULL);
146 #endif  /* SMP */
147
148 #endif  /* _KERNEL */
